    Hello all!

    I started Atkins on November 4 and had great success the first week. I went from 198-189 lbs. *yay* But I have noticed the past 4-5 days that I haven't lost anymore..nor inches. Not even 1lb.

    Most of my excercise has been house work but a couple days a week I do Turbo Jam and Exercise ball *Core strength workout*. I'm doing the same things but I am not eating as much. I do not have much of an appetite at all during the day, the mornings is when i'm actually feeling a little hungry but then when I got to eat..I'm like "ugh"..but I do make myself eat. There has been a few days that I have had under 600 calories for the entire day. Could this be why I'm not losing? I don't know what to do, I am certainly NOT giving up. I just need some help. I know for sure I need some patience.

    Any comments are appreciated and I would love to buddy up with someone if anyone is looking for a partner.

        First, let me congratulate you on your weightloss success thus far!


        I agree with everything Validrouge and Becky Sue had to say, but:

        I will say that if there are days you are only eating 600 calories...that really can stall your progress...you have to think of your metabolism like a fireplace...(bear with me)

        When you initially start a fire...it takes a lot of wood to get it going...kindling...newspaper...and lots of billowing air onto it...

        Much like eating breakfast to kick start the metabolism...

        Then the fire continues to burn throughout the day...and only needs a few sticks of wood (energy...food) to keep it going...

        But if you let the fire go out..by not adding wood (energy...food) Then you have to start the fire (metabolism) all over again...

        Fireplaces aside....

        It isn't good for your blood sugar levels either...my doctor has informed me that peaks and valleys (i.e.: eating a great deal, as well as, eating too little) can monumentally screw up your insulin production in your body...eventually leading to insulin resistance...something I'm currently battling.

        I hope this can atleast serve as food for thought. Don't take my word as the gospel, but something to look into and consider. How much water do you get in a day?

                  There is a phenomenon that some Atkineers experience: it's a mini-stall between weeks 3-6 of this diet. This thread is devoted to that:
                  http://www.atkinsdietbulletinboard.c...ead.php?t=1378

                  Also be aware that Atkins is a high fat diet, not a high protein diet. At least 65% of you daily calories should be from fat.

                      You can drink it, but it doesn't count towards the daily water minimum of 64 ounces daily.

                      Just be aware, your mileage might vary on this product. If you notice any weight loss issues or if you notice any blood sugar instability symptoms (see the chart in Ch 12 DANDR 2002), drop the tea from your menu, ASAP.
